Hewlett-Packard Co yesterday added the HP9000 Model 835 with TurboSRX, touting it as the fastest workstation on the market today, rendering photorealistic images and three dimensional interactive graphics three to 10 times faster than the company’s SRX subsystems in the 9000 Models 350 and 825. The Model 835 is rated at 14 MIPS and 2.02 double-precision MFLOPS. Hewlett claims that the features of the TurboSRX enable users design objects as fast as a thought occurs, and that they look so realistic as to obviate the need for making models. TurboSRX, also available with the HP9000/350, does 900,000 transformations per second, 240,000 three-dimensional vectors per second, and 50,000 clipped, checked 50-pixel triangles per second. The Model 835 RISC is about UKP60,000 and Hewlett-Packard will start taking orders for it here from April 1.
